My Buying Guides on Arrow T 50 Staples

What I Look for in Arrow T 50 Staples

When I shop for Arrow T 50 staples, I first make sure they match my stapler model. These staples are made for Arrow T50 staple guns and similar tools, so compatibility is the most important thing for me. I also check the crown width, leg length, and material type because these details affect how well the staples hold and what kind of projects I can use them for.

Choosing the Right Leg Length

I always pay close attention to leg length because it determines how deeply the staple goes into the material. For thin fabrics or light upholstery, I prefer shorter legs. For thicker wood, insulation, or heavier projects, I go with longer legs. Picking the wrong size can cause weak fastening or make the staple too hard to drive in.

Material and Durability

In my experience, staple material matters a lot. I usually choose galvanized or stainless steel staples when I want better resistance to rust and corrosion. If I’m working indoors on simple projects, standard steel staples are often enough. For outdoor or long-term use, I like to spend a little more on stronger, more durable options.

Project Type Matters

I always think about what I’m using the staples for before buying. For upholstery, I want staples that hold fabric firmly without damaging it. For insulation or light carpentry, I need staples that penetrate cleanly and stay secure. Matching the staple type to the job helps me avoid waste and frustration.

Quantity and Value

I usually compare pack sizes before I buy. If I have a big project, I prefer larger boxes because they give me better value and save me from running out too soon. For occasional use, smaller packs make more sense. I try to balance price, quantity, and how often I actually use my stapler.

Ease of Loading and Performance

I like staples that load smoothly into my stapler and feed without jamming. A good staple should drive consistently and hold well on the first try. If I have to deal with frequent misfires or jams, it slows me down and makes the job more annoying than it should be.
